Electrc 2011 NEC Calculator is a suite of tools that performs your most
common electrical design calculations in full compliance with the 2011
National Electrical Code.


Conductor sizing:

  • User selectable 2008 NEC or 2011 NEC ampacities and ambient temperature ratings
  • Single or parallel (up to 12) conductors per phase
  • Voltage drop, circuit type, ambient temperature and quantity of current carrying
    conductors derating
  • Terminal temperature factoring
  • New rooftop raceway derating
  • Many built-in conductor types
  • User defined custom conductors


Conduit & Trough Fill:

  • Any combination of conductors per fill calculation including bare and custom conductors
  • 13 raceway types plus trough
  • Alternate raceway size option.


Motor Calculations:

  • User selectable 2008 NEC or 2011 NEC ampacities and ambient temperature ratings
  • Motor conductor, overcurrent and overload sizing
  • Single or parallel (up to 12) conductors per phase
  • Voltage drop, circuit type, ambient temperature and quantity current carrying conductors
    derating
  • Terminal temperature factoring
  • Rooftop raceway derating
  • Many built-in conductor types
  • User defined custom conductors
  • Single phase motors up to 10 Hp
  • Three phase motors up to 500 Hp.


Lighting Design:

  • Many built-in lighting fixtures and lamps
  • Specify your own fixtures and lamps
  • Reflectance and maintenance factor parameters
  • Standard and reverse lighting calculations


Panel Directory:

  • Print panelboard directories in two sizes (4 x 6 or 6 x 8 inch)
  • Up to 84 circuits per panelboard
  • Optional footer text.


Transformer Sizing:

  • Solve for kva rating or load amperage
  • Primary and secondary overcurrent protection
  • Distribution and autotransformer types.


Fault Current Calculations:

  • Point to point method, up to 10 points on each distribution system.
  • Calculate fault current at the end of a run of conductors
  • Calculate fault current at the secondary of a transformer
  • Calculate fault current downstream from the secondary of a transformer


Voltage Drop:

  • Calculates the voltage drop on existing or proposed resistive (100% power factor) circuits.


Power Factor Correction:

  • Calculates the existing power factor, and determines the quantity of capacitive Kvars
    needed to arrive at a new power factor
  • Shows the amount of distribution system losses that would be freed-up at the new
    power factor.


Box Fill and Sizing:

  • Calculates the volumetric capacity, in cubic inches, of device or splice boxes, required for
    any quantity of conductors, devices, and fittings.


Quick-Reference Tables:

  • Reference tables from the NEC. Conductor ampacity, box volumes, equipment ground
    conductors, grounding electrode conductors, underground cover requirements, terminal
    temperature limitations, and more.


File Save/Load:

  • All program function allow you to save project files for future reference or reuse.


Professional, detailed printed reports:

  • Viewable in print preview, or sent to printer.


Quick-Calculators:

  • Ohm's Law
  • AC/DC Formulas
  • Cost to Operate (standard and demand metering)
